MrBeast Files Trademark for Crypto Exchange and Financial Services
- James Stephen Donaldson, known as MrBeast, filed a trademark for “MrBeast Financial” aimed at launching a downloadable app offering cryptocurrency exchange and payment processing services.
- The application includes services such as investment banking, insurance, financial wellness education, microfinance lending, and the exchange of cryptocurrency via decentralized exchanges (DEXs).
- To launch the platform, MrBeast would need to register with FinCEN as a Money Services Business and obtain state-level money transmitter licenses, along with approvals from the SEC or CFTC.
- As of now, no filings have been made for these regulatory requirements.
- This trademark joins a portfolio of over fifty others owned by his company, some of which have become actual products or services.
MrBeast’s move into the crypto space with “MrBeast Financial” indicates his interest in expanding his brand into financial services involving cryptocurrency. However, regulatory hurdles remain before any launch can occur.
